“…Strontium fluoride powders Sr 0.96 Yb 0.02 Er 0.02 F 2.04 , Sr 0.95 Yb 0.03 Er 0.02 F 2.05 and Sr 0.935 Yb 0.050 Er 0.015 F 2.065 were synthesised by the co-precipitation from aqueous solution technique using NaF, KFÁ2H 2 O and NH 4 F as fluorinating agents according to the previously reported protocol. 38 The precursors were Sr(NO 3 ) 2 , Yb(NO 3 ) 3 Á6H 2 O, Er(NO 3 ) 3 Á5H 2 O (99.99%, LANHIT, Russia), NaF (pure, Fluorine Salts Chemical Plant LLC, Russia), KFÁ2H 2 O (pure, Fluorine Salts Chemical Plant LLC, Russia), NH 4 F (pure for chemical analysis, Fluorine Salts Chemical Plant LLC, Russia) and double distilled water. The reactants were used without any additional purification steps.…”
